What is haram before marriage in Islam?

In Islam, premarital sex (fornication), as well as sex outside marriage (adultery) are absolutely forbidden and considered grave sins that bear serious consequences in this world and the hereafter (Quran 24:2).

What is halal dating?

Halal dating is a way for Muslims to learn about one another to decide if they want to be married, while at the same time observing the beliefs of Islam. When Muslim men and women date one another, it is with the intention of marrying one another or deciding against marrying.

Is it halal to kiss before marriage?

What is haram before marriage in Islam? Sexual, lustful, and affectionate acts such as kissing, touching, staring, etc. are haram in Islam before marriage because these are considered portions of zina, which lead to the actual zina itself.

What is the biggest sin in Islam?

The greatest of the sins described as al-Kaba'ir is the association of others with Allah or Shirk.

Is it haram to talk to the opposite gender?

Does Islam permit friendships with members of the opposite gender? The fact that Sharia has laid down rules for interaction between genders implies that such interactions are allowed, since had it been absolutely prohibited, there would have been no prescribed conditions and guidance in the Qur'an.


How to date a girl in Islam?

According to the Quran, males and females who are unmarried should not spend time alone together. Women should be accompanied by a relative whenever they meet with a man, even if they are potential suitors. Some Muslims are open to meeting as long as it's in a public place (e.g. a coffee date at a cafe).

Are Muslims allowed to dance?

While moderate Muslims generally don't object to music and dancing per se, a large portion of the faithful view sexually suggestive movement, racy lyrics, and unmarried couples dancing together as haram, because they may lead to un-Islamic behavior.

Can you say I love you in Islam?

Uhibbuk أحبك is the most common standard way to say I love you in Arabic. It is a part of Modern Standard Arabic (MSA, a.k.a. fusHa العربية الفصحى) and is therefore recognized in all dialects. You would say uhibbuk أحبك if you're addressing a male and if you're addressing a woman, you would use uhibbuki أحبكِ.
